Bridging the Gap: Water Quality Challenges in Remote Australian Hospitals

By Published On: August 11, 2025Categories: Water Management

Clean water is essential for effective medical care in hospitals and healthcare facilities. Every aspect of patient care, from basic hygiene to complex surgeries, relies on having water readily available. This extends to medical equipment as well. Surgical instruments and medical devices must be sterilised with clean water to prevent infections during operations.

Contaminated water can lead to infections and other health issues, putting already vulnerable patients at greater risk. Additionally, water ensures the proper functioning of a healthcare establishment, used in heating and cooling systems, laundry, and sanitation services. Hospitals need a dependable water supply to keep these systems running smoothly, which supports a cleaner and safer environment for patients and staff.

 

Key Issues in Managing Water Quality in Hospitals

Maintaining water quality in Australian hospitals comes with its own set of challenges, with some unique to hospitals located in remote regions. For example, while many urban hospitals are equipped with extensive infrastructure and readily available water resources, those in remote areas may not have the same access, and this presents a problem that local councils and water authorities have to consider.

1. Absence of Real-Time Monitoring

It’s difficult to manage water quality in hospitals successfully without the implementation of a system that can monitor water data in real time. Without live data, it’s harder to detect abnormal changes until much later.

As a result, most actions are triggered by incidents instead of an ongoing risk assessment and preventative maintenance work. Water management policies may often default to meeting the bare minimum of compliance and reporting.

2. Geographical Factors

Remote hospitals may have geographical barriers that make ensuring water quality difficult. Many hospitals are located in areas with rugged terrain, making it challenging to transport clean water or install necessary infrastructure with limited road access and long distances.

3. Infrastructure Issues

Another significant challenge for both urban and rural hospitals is with infrastructure and maintenance issues. Some hospitals have complex and outdated plumbing systems and equipment, such as old pipes and treatment tanks, that may result in corrosion and leaks. Furthermore, plumbing systems that aren’t properly maintained are like ticking time bombs.

4. Skill Shortages

Delivering clean and quality water requires experts who can manage, maintain, and repair water systems. Local governments in remote locations may struggle to find and retain qualified staff. This shortage makes it difficult to quickly isolate and control any water contamination incident.

5. Meeting Compliance

Some remote regions see harsh and severe weather conditions, making it harder to deliver clean, safe drinking water and maintain compliance throughout the year. Although not a challenge specific to remote hospitals, trying to keep up with evolving regulations can be a convoluted and resource-intensive process.

 

How Smart Water Quality Management Improves Healthcare Facilities

Beyond implementing filtration and purification systems, you need an effective system to monitor and proactively manage water quality. To address these challenges, consider comprehensive water management strategies, including:

1. Implementing an Advanced Monitoring Technology

One of the key steps in improving water quality is to have visibility over your data, and this is where real-time water quality monitoring systems help prevent major health incidents before they happen.

By using sensors and an automated monitoring system, you can continuously monitor water quality with only a few staff members. Everything can be done remotely, and you can set instant alerts when a data anomaly is detected so you can take immediate action if needed.

2. Using An Intelligent System to Analyse Water Quality Data

Data is meaningless without a thorough analysis. A smart water management solution is capable of processing a vast amount of data and producing a comprehensive summary or report that can inform your next decision. It excels at identifying patterns within the data that might be missed by manual inspection, allowing you to take the right steps.

3. Developing a Robust Water Management Plan

A robust water management plan should outline the procedures for monitoring water quality, maintaining treatment systems, optimising processes, conducting maintenance work, and meeting regulatory compliance.

Another consideration for remote areas is water usage optimisation. Hospitals require a large amount of water to function, and it’s prudent to plan on how you can manage consumption efficiently, especially in water-scarce regions.

4. Establishing a Comprehensive Emergency Response Plan

Although real-time monitoring and alerts can prevent most disasters, sometimes, things can simply get out of hand. Think swift isolation, rapid detection of contamination source(s), and effective remediation strategies. Having a robust monitoring system and well-defined disaster response protocols will help to quickly de-escalate any emergency events.
